Humor Disabled to Boycott ‘Thunder’

Michael Cieply reports in the New York Times that several groups representing people with disabilities are expected to announce a boycott of the new comedy Tropic Thunder as early as Monday. At issue is the frequent use of the word “retard” in the film, a Hollywood satire about the filming of a war picture.
